教學(xué)內(nèi)容:人民出版社2018年版本綜合實(shí)踐活動(dòng)小學(xué)四年級(jí)下冊(cè)第六課《小小程序員之聽話的小魚》。
教學(xué)目標(biāo):
1.通過手動(dòng)控制小魚上下左右移動(dòng)(當(dāng)按下“空格”鍵);
2.根據(jù)需要調(diào)用小魚不同的造型(換成“XX”造型);
3.通過說話模塊增強(qiáng)人機(jī)互動(dòng)(說“你好”);
4.嘗試改變小魚的大小與顏色(將大小增加、將顏色特效增加)。
學(xué)情分析:
學(xué)生是四年級(jí),剛開始接觸編程學(xué)習(xí),基礎(chǔ)較弱。本次學(xué)習(xí)屬于基礎(chǔ)應(yīng)用階段。學(xué)生對(duì)編輯界面有所了解,對(duì)模塊有一定了解。
教學(xué)重點(diǎn)分析及解決措施:
1.通過使用“當(dāng)按下‘空格’鍵”和“將x坐標(biāo)增加”“將y坐標(biāo)增加”模塊實(shí)現(xiàn)將小魚上下左右移動(dòng)。
2.通過復(fù)制與鏡像生成小魚新的角色造型,并通過“換成XX造型”模塊根據(jù)需要調(diào)用不同的造型,實(shí)現(xiàn)小魚魚頭分別朝左和朝右移動(dòng)。
3.通過“說‘你好’‘2’妙”模塊實(shí)現(xiàn)人機(jī)互動(dòng)。
4.探索如何增加小魚的數(shù)量,改變小魚的大小和顏色,播放聲音等,從而優(yōu)化作品。
教學(xué)形式:理論與實(shí)踐結(jié)合、人機(jī)互動(dòng)、直播展示、課后分享與評(píng)價(jià)。
教學(xué)準(zhǔn)備:
1.核桃編程智慧教室搭建;
2.學(xué)生獲取個(gè)人學(xué)習(xí)賬號(hào);
3.希沃授課助手直播功能的使用;
4.隨堂音樂,實(shí)操鞏固時(shí)使用。
教學(xué)過程:
一、探究竟、勇作為(20分鐘)
(一)溫舊啟新,蓄勢(shì)待發(fā)(5分鐘)
1.談話導(dǎo)入:今天我們?cè)僖淮蝸淼搅藢W(xué)校微機(jī)室,在編程世界里,我們可以想我們所想,做我們所做,盡情發(fā)揮我們的聰明才智,創(chuàng)造屬于我們自己的作品。大家有沒有信心,把今天的作品創(chuàng)作好呢?
2.復(fù)習(xí)舊知:首先我們來復(fù)習(xí)一下這些模塊,在黑板上展示,并讓學(xué)生說一說各模塊的作用:當(dāng)按下“空格”鍵、將x坐標(biāo)增加、將y坐標(biāo)增加、當(dāng)角色被點(diǎn)擊、說“你好”“2”秒模塊、重復(fù)執(zhí)行模塊。
【設(shè)計(jì)意圖:通過談話激發(fā)學(xué)生學(xué)習(xí)欲望,在情感上提升學(xué)生學(xué)習(xí)的專注力;通過復(fù)習(xí)已知模塊,激活學(xué)生已有認(rèn)知,為本課學(xué)習(xí)提供智力上的支持?!?/p>
(二)謀劃布局,世界由我(3分鐘)
1.進(jìn)入平臺(tái):大家打開谷歌瀏覽器,輸入網(wǎng)址:edu.hetao101.com,進(jìn)入核桃智慧教室樂平市第十一小學(xué)課堂,然后用自己的賬號(hào)與密碼登錄。大家點(diǎn)擊練習(xí)器,打開圖形化編程練習(xí)器。大家可以看到一個(gè)原始的舞臺(tái)和一個(gè)角色核桃君。
2.切入主題:今天我們要?jiǎng)?chuàng)作的作品是——聽話的小魚。那么同學(xué)們想一想,我們需要一個(gè)怎樣的背景?又需要什么角色?
3.設(shè)定目標(biāo):魚是生活在水里的,因此江河湖海、溝渠溪流就是我們所需要的了。那么我們選擇一個(gè)海底世界吧。然后再添加一條漂亮的小魚。
4.選擇背景:那么接下來,我們就可以開始動(dòng)手創(chuàng)建我們想要啥世界了。我們先點(diǎn)擊舞臺(tái)左上角齒輪,然后在“背景”標(biāo)簽下點(diǎn)擊“選擇背景”,輸入“海底”搜索,選擇自己喜歡的一個(gè)海底背景。
5.設(shè)置角色:接著把“核桃君”角色刪除,然后點(diǎn)擊添加角色,輸入“魚”進(jìn)行搜索,選擇其中自己喜歡的一個(gè)“魚”角色??梢愿鶕?jù)需要在界面下端大小框內(nèi)設(shè)置角色大小。
【設(shè)計(jì)意圖:進(jìn)入編輯器,根據(jù)需要添加背景和設(shè)置角色,這是Scratch語言編程的基本操作,也是編程思維的開端。】
(三)循序漸進(jìn),佳作欲出(12分鐘)
1.四處移動(dòng),隨心所欲(5分鐘)
目標(biāo):通過“當(dāng)按下‘空格’鍵”、“將x坐標(biāo)增加”“將y坐標(biāo)增加”等模塊讓“魚”上下左右移動(dòng)起來。
(1)選中“魚”角色,在“事件”標(biāo)簽下選擇“當(dāng)按下‘空格’鍵”,按住鼠標(biāo)左鍵拖出到編輯區(qū)內(nèi),將“空格”改為“→”。
(2)然后在“運(yùn)動(dòng)”標(biāo)簽下選中“將x坐標(biāo)增加‘10’”拖出放置在“當(dāng)按下→鍵”下方,組合成一段代碼。此段代碼表示每按一次右方向鍵,角色就往右移動(dòng)10步。
(3)通過類似或復(fù)制的方法,并做適當(dāng)修改,手動(dòng)控制操作上下左右方向鍵實(shí)現(xiàn)小魚角色向上、向下、向左、向右移動(dòng)。
此時(shí)觀察:小魚向左、向右移動(dòng)有什么問題?
魚頭一直是朝向一個(gè)方向,魚應(yīng)該是向前面移動(dòng)才對(duì),而不是后退。
那么,我們有什么方法可以解決這個(gè)問題呢?
2.略加變化,更加智能(7分鐘)
(1)讓小魚左右移動(dòng)時(shí),魚頭朝向移動(dòng)方向。
為了讓魚頭朝向與小魚移動(dòng)方向一致,我們可以使用變換造型模塊實(shí)現(xiàn)。
①點(diǎn)擊“魚”角色左上角齒輪,在造型標(biāo)簽下制作魚頭朝右的造型。首先點(diǎn)擊右側(cè)第一個(gè)圖標(biāo)復(fù)制一個(gè)造型,在復(fù)制的造型上點(diǎn)擊修改標(biāo)簽,通過鏡像生成一個(gè)魚頭朝右的造型。
②在外觀標(biāo)簽下選擇“換成…造型”模塊插入到“當(dāng)按下→鍵”和“將x坐標(biāo)增加10”模塊中間,并把造型換成魚頭朝右造型。
③同理把“換成…造型”模塊插入到“當(dāng)按下←鍵”和“將x坐標(biāo)增加-10”模塊中間,并把造型換成魚頭朝左造型。
(2)當(dāng)小魚被點(diǎn)擊時(shí)會(huì)說話“我是個(gè)聽話的小魚,控制我行動(dòng)吧!”
為了增強(qiáng)人機(jī)互動(dòng)效果,讓作品更有趣,可以讓小魚說話。
在事件標(biāo)簽下,拖出“當(dāng)角色被點(diǎn)擊”模塊,在外觀標(biāo)簽下拖出“說‘你好!’‘2’秒”模塊放置“當(dāng)角色被點(diǎn)擊”模塊下方,將“你好!”修改成“我是個(gè)聽話的小魚,控制我行動(dòng)吧!”。
【設(shè)計(jì)意圖:通過添加造型、變換造型讓小魚移動(dòng)更自然,促進(jìn)學(xué)生學(xué)會(huì)思考,讓作品更合理化。通過說話模塊的使用,設(shè)置人機(jī)互動(dòng)環(huán)節(jié),增加作品的趣味性,這是編程的一大思維模式,更是編程發(fā)展的思維方向。】
二、創(chuàng)新園、啟智慧(15分鐘)
經(jīng)過前面大家的努力與思考,我們已經(jīng)完成了一件作品。那么怎樣可以讓作品內(nèi)容更豐富、更美觀、更有趣呢?
1.怎樣改變魚的大小?
當(dāng)按下w鍵,將小魚大小增加10。當(dāng)按下s鍵,將小魚大小增加-10。
2.怎樣改變魚的顏色?
當(dāng)按下a鍵,將小魚顏色特效增加25。當(dāng)按下d鍵,將小魚顏色特效增加-25。
3.怎樣增加更多的魚?
添加角色,選擇兩三只小魚。給新添加的角色小魚編寫移動(dòng)代碼。當(dāng)開始被點(diǎn)擊→重復(fù)執(zhí)行→內(nèi)嵌:移到x:y:和重復(fù)執(zhí)行直到(碰到“舞臺(tái)邊緣”?)→內(nèi)嵌:移動(dòng)-10步→等待0.2秒。同理編寫其它小魚的代碼。
4.怎樣添加音樂?
代碼:點(diǎn)開始被點(diǎn)擊→重復(fù)執(zhí)行→內(nèi)嵌:播放聲音→等待0.2秒。
【設(shè)計(jì)意圖:通過手動(dòng)控制使用各種鍵改變小魚的大小、顏色,讓學(xué)生領(lǐng)悟到凡事是可以改變的,進(jìn)一步體驗(yàn)想得到就可以做得到的編程思想。通過增加小魚的數(shù)量以及播放聲音,讓學(xué)生感受豐富作品與生活都在于人們自己的創(chuàng)造。只要?jiǎng)?chuàng)新,一切皆有可能?!?/p>
三、展評(píng)臺(tái)、樹自信(5分鐘)
1.成果展示。通過希沃授課助手直播功能用手機(jī)直播展示學(xué)生優(yōu)秀作品。
2.總結(jié)評(píng)價(jià)。
自我評(píng)價(jià);同學(xué)評(píng)價(jià);老師評(píng)價(jià);家長(zhǎng)評(píng)價(jià)。保存并轉(zhuǎn)發(fā)作品。
【設(shè)計(jì)意圖:通過手機(jī)直播,讓學(xué)生感受同伴們不同的創(chuàng)作與思維。通過多角度評(píng)價(jià),尤其是作品分享,收獲親朋好友的贊賞與鼓勵(lì),從而樹立信心,激發(fā)在編程世界里的興趣,進(jìn)而在心靈深處種下一顆夢(mèng)想的種子。】
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請(qǐng)發(fā)送郵件至 sumchina520@foxmail.com 舉報(bào),一經(jīng)查實(shí),本站將立刻刪除。